Originally Posted by Bowtie Boy grats man. how do you get into something like that? | Back in June of this year, I was at the Camaro Nationals, which is held yearly in Carlisle, Pa. I noticed two fellows checking my car out and they approached me. One of them handed me his business card, he was the Editor of GM High Tech Performance magazine, and he said they would like to do an article about my SS. I was likw WOW! Out of the hundreds of cars at the event and they picked my car!
We left the fairgrounds and went to a location where they did a photo shoot and we even went out on the interstate where they directed me from their truck and took some more shots. |
